Jenkins执行python写的selenium自动化脚本,通常会遇到,执行打不开浏览器,查看jenkins构建Console Output控制台输出信息,发现脚本是执行了的,但是出错了,打开浏览器出现问题,原因呢,是因为我们window安装的jenkins默认会产生一个window ...
目录 目录 步骤 安装插件运行python脚本所需插件 构建第一个python的job 步骤 安装插件运行python脚本所需插件 回到Jenkins初始界面,在左侧菜单栏找到系统管理 进入系统管理界面后,点击管理插件 点击可选插件选项,在右上角搜索框搜索python plugin,点击安装即可 也可以下载安装包,在高级选项下根据提示安装 构建第一个python的job 回到Jenkins初始界面 ...
2018-05-08 16:36 0 1775 推荐指数:
Jenkins执行python写的selenium自动化脚本,通常会遇到,执行打不开浏览器,查看jenkins构建Console Output控制台输出信息,发现脚本是执行了的,但是出错了,打开浏览器出现问题,原因呢,是因为我们window安装的jenkins默认会产生一个window ...
有A,B,C三个 Job ,A为服务或web Job,B,C为A依赖的其它 Job 单独建个 Job ,按B,C,A的顺序进行编译 1、安装插件: Multijob plugin 2、新建A,B,C三个Job ...
构建选择Excute Windows batch command 下面是python脚本,注意字符集 GBK runtest.py record.py codeLine.py ...
官方文档: 需求:当1个job启动构建后,获取它的构建状态.(成功,失败,驳回,构建中,正在排队) 关键函数: 获取job是否在排队的结果 获取正在排队构建的job队列 即pending状态中的所有job,如果没有 pending状态的job即返回1个空列表 ...
操作很简单: * 最新版本的Jenkins,插件管理中下载两个python需要的插: * 重启Jenkins 任务中添加python脚本即可,点击保存时候,自动会在下图中目录生成.py文件 过程如下 * 插件: * python脚本: * 保存 ...
新建jenkins的一个工程 创建测试工程: 接下来创建1个测试job,验证自己的想法 启动该job,需要传递1个字符型参数,参数名是Para1,默认值是:参数1 在shell中打印Para1的参数值: Python代码示例: https ...
最近要开发1个接口,接收到1个指令后自动触发自动化测试,虽然也可以通过shell命令做这一步,但因为目前所有构建自动化的的动作都通过jenkins完成,所以想要尝试能不能用python去控制jenkins构建job。还真有!万能的python。想起来一句话,有趣的事,python永远不会缺席 ...
在jenkins 构建任务时,同时只能构建2个,但是有时候可能涉及到需要同时执行多个任务(大于2个),如果不能同时运行的话,就需要等待上一个执行完了,再执行第三个 比如用例非常多,需要把不同的用例分给不同的job同时执行,以减少执行时间 如果两个没有job没有结束,构建 ...